Main point:
Raludotatug deruxtecan, an investigational antibody-drug conjugate targeting CDH6, has received Breakthrough Therapy Designation from the FDA for treating platinum-resistant epithelial ovarian cancer, primary peritoneal, or fallopian tube cancers expressing CDH6.
Key Details:
* What it is indeed: Raludotatug deruxtecan is a first-in-class CDH6-directed antibody-drug conjugate.
* Companies Involved: Developed by Merck and Daiichi Sankyo.
* Basis for Designation: The designation is based on data from two clinical trials:
* Phase 1 Trial: Evaluated safety and efficacy in 179 adults with advanced ovarian cancer previously treated with platinum-based chemotherapy and a taxane. Focused on determining the maximum tolerated dose and assessing safety in ovarian and renal cell carcinoma patients.
* REJOICE-Ovarian01 (Phase 2/3 Trial): A larger trial involving approximately 710 patients with platinum-resistant ovarian cancer.
* Phase 2: Determining the optimal dose (4.8mg/kg, 5.6mg/kg, or 6.4mg/kg) based on objective response rate (ORR).
* Phase 3: Comparing raludotatug deruxtecan to investigator’s choice of chemotherapy, with ORR and progression-free survival (PFS) as primary endpoints.
* Importance: Patients with platinum-resistant ovarian cancer have limited treatment options, making this a possibly important new therapy.
